Taoyuan Pauian Pilots guard Justin Lu yesterday made history after being named the first back-to-back P.League+ Player of the Month.

Lu’s 15.4-point performance in December helped the Pilots conclude last year with seven straight wins and the 25-year-old extended the hot streak as the Pilots went 4-1 through last month.

Despite a schedule curtailed by the Lunar New Year, Lu averaged 21.4 points, and 33 minutes, 50 seconds per game over five outings, both team highs for the Pilots.

In addition, Lu averaged 4.6 rebounds, 3.4 assists and 1.6 steals per game, with double-digit scoring performances in all five games.

A few records highlighted Lu’s and the Pilots’ January during that stretch, including becoming the P.League+’s fastest player to nail 100 three-pointers (38 games) and setting the league’s longest win streak of 10 games.

The Pilots also matched the league record for consecutive home wins by going undefeated in their first eight games of the season at Taoyuan Arena.

Lu is on an 11-game streak with at least 10 points — the longest active streak of any local player — and is only four games short of tying the 15-game record set by the New Taipei Kings’ Amigo Yang.

Yang, 38, set that record in the 30-game 2021-2022 season.

He finished the season averaging 20 points, 4.9 rebounds, three assists, and 1.3 steals per game, with a 38 percent field-goal record to be named the league’s regular-season Most Valuable Player and making the All-P.League+ team.

Each team is scheduled to play 40 games this season and with more than a half season left, Lu has a shot at breaking Yang’s record.

However, the Pilots standout faces a stiff test against back-to-back champions the Taipei Fubon Braves tomorrow.

The previous time the two teams faced off was on Jan. 28, when the Braves handed the Pilots an 86-74 loss in Taipei that snapped the visitor’s winning streak, seeing Lu shoot one for 10 for three-pointers to collect 16 points.

Over the two sides’ two games this season, Lu has averaged 13 points, making just 25 percent of his field goals and struggling from behind the arc to go one for 18 (5.6 percent).
